Despite the advanced features of Windows operating systems, there are still times where some common problems crop up. Let’s look at some of these problems and see how we can repair these PC errors.

1. Display problems. Perhaps you see flickers on the screen or there are extra lines showing that should not be there. Or perhaps the screen seems ‘laggy’, freezing at odd moments. This may indicate that it’s time to update your display card driver. Be sure to download the latest correct drivers from the manufacturer and install them. After the install, restart your computer

.

2. No sound, or choppy sound. This is a hint that you may have the wrong drivers or need to update your existing sound drivers to the latest version. Very often, people expect sound to work out of the box, but getting sound to work properly can be a hassle at times.
